So would Princess match that? No Princess will not "match" an OBC given by a travel agency. If you have a FCC with Princess you will still get the applicable OBC that is associated with the FCC in addition to any OBC offered by an agency. Doug&Nadine Posted August 31, 2008 #17 Share Posted August 31, 2008 This is out of the CCL annual report http://media.corporate-ir.net/media_files/irol/14/140690/CCL07AR.pdf Carnival Corporation & plc is pleased to extend the following benefit to our shareholders: North United ContinentalAmerican Kingdom European AustralianBrands Brands Brands BrandOnboard credit per stateroom on sailings of 14 days or longer US $250 £ 125 ¤ 250 AUD 250Onboard credit per stateroom on sailings of 7 to 13 days+ US $100 £ 50 ¤ 100 AUD 100Onboard credit per stateroom on sailings of 6 days or less US $ 50 £ 25 ¤ 50 AUD 50This benefit is applicable on sailings through July 31, 2009 aboard the brands listed below. Certain restrictions apply. Applications to receive thesebenefits must be made prior to cruise departure date.This benefit is available to shareholders holding a minimum of 100 shares of Carnival Corporation or Carnival plc. Employees, travel agentscruisingat travel agent rates, tour conductors or anyone cruising on a reduced-rate or complimentary basis are excluded from this offer. Thisbenefit is not transferable and cannot be used for casino credits/charges and gratuities charged to your onboard account. Only one onboard creditper shareholder-occupied stateroom. Reservations must be made by February 28, 2009.Please provide your name, reservation number, ship and sailing date, along with proof of ownership of Carnival Corporation or Carnival plcshares (i.e., photocopy of shareholder proxy card, shares certificate or a current brokerage ornominee statement) and the initial deposit to yourtravel agent or to the cruise line you have selected.
